AI Summary
-
Extends age eligibility for California's Housing Navigation and Maintenance Program from 18-24 years old to 18-28 years old for young adults securing and maintaining housing
-
Prioritizes funding for nonminor dependents and young adults formerly in the state's foster care or probation system under the Housing Navigation and Maintenance Program
-
Specifies eligible uses of program funding including: housing application assistance, federal housing choice voucher applications, financial assistance for security deposits and move-in costs, landlord incentives, and supportive services like case management and employment support
-
Requires county child welfare agencies to report new data annually, including the number of young adults served who were homeless at program entry and information about housing voucher partnerships with local housing authorities
-
Mandates the Department of Housing and Community Development to publicly release annual data on housing authority partnerships and voucher issuance under the federal Family Unification Program and Foster Youth to Independence Initiative
